How to Keep Birth, Death, Marriage, Unmarried and Divorce Records

When any child comes into this world, he has to be registered wherever he is living. Registering a newborn child means telling the local authorities that a new human has come to this world and will be living in the country. The same is the case with marriages and divorces. New marriages and divorces should also be registered, as the government has to keep records of everything for legal and administrative matters. Here’s a short guide on how to keep your birth, death, marriage, and divorce records so that you have the official proof of all these events and the authorities also get to know about these events.

Nadra Birth Certificate Records:

In order to keep birth records, you have to do a few things just after the child has been born, firstly, the hospital where your child has been born will give you the hospital birth card.

Secondly, you will take the child for his early vaccination, and he will receive a vaccination card. Keep that card safe, as you will need it when you will go for your child’s birth certificate. Lastly, you will have to make your child’s b form or birth certificate. Keep all these documents somewhere safe, as your kid will need them later in their life.

Nadra Death Certificate Records:

When a person dies, the death has to be reported to the relevant authorities. You will receive the hospital slip on which the time of death and cause of death will be mentioned. This slip will be needed for making the death certificate. As soon as you get the death certificate, you have to keep it safe for death records and further property matters.

Nadra Marriage Certificate Records:

To keep marriage records, one has to do the following:

  • Get your nikah nama from the nikah registrar and keep it somewhere safe
  • Go to the Nadra office and register your marriage
  • After registering your marriage, apply for your marriage certificate and get it from your nearest Nadra office
  • The woman should renew her Cnic after marriage to change her relationship status

 

After getting all the important marriage-related documents, try to keep them somewhere accessible and safe.

Nadra Divorce Certificate Records:

If your marriage ends up in a divorce, you will have to get your divorce deed and divorce papers. Keep all these documents with you as you will need them for your future marriage and also as proof of your divorce.
